Impact:
The insights generated from this project will provide the Financial Products Manager with a clearer understanding of complaint trends and branch-level performance. This will support data-driven decisions such as identifying which agents may need one-on-one performance reviews or pairing high-performing agents with those who are underperforming. It can also help justify funding requests for additional staff in high-demand branches, guide agents on how to better educate customers about financial products, and inform strategic decisions about where new branches may need to open across the country.
Client Feedback:
When reviewing the dashboard, there were a few areas for improvement. The colour palette could be refined by reducing the opacity of the purple tones used throughout the report to enhance visual clarity. Additionally, the KPI donut charts should be adjusted to filter the data rather than simply highlight it, allowing for a more interactive and intuitive user experience. For future presentations, it would be more effective to walk the client through the dashboard by focusing on a specific segment, demonstrating how to navigate the visuals and extract meaningful insights. It's also important to ask the client if there's anything specific they would like to see included, to ensure the dashboard fully meets their needs.
